I know in Ontario now the provincial government has scrapped the 2015 sex education curriculum, and with it, lessons on gender expression, gender identity, same-sex marriage, same-sex relationships and sexual orientation. There have been groups and individuals, ranging from the Canadian Civil Liberties Association to teachers, health educators, medical professionals, social workers, parents and students, who have come out very strongly in recent weeks and months against these changes imposed by the Ontario provincial government.
As people who work with the trans and LGBTQ community, can you speak to the impact of those changes within the Ontario education system on young people?
